Activities To Do In Pahalgam

Pahalgam is one of the most famous tourist destinations in Kashmir. This place is located in the southern district of Kashmir and is known for vast meadows, forest cover and Amarnath ji Yatra.

Pahalgam Tour Guide Complete

Best Activities To Do In Pahalgam

There are many activities that you can enjoy in your trip to Pahalgam. This is a round the year tourist destination that offers varied activities catering to the demands of both adventure seekers as well as calm travelers. Some of the activities that you can enjoy in Pahalgam are:

  1. Trekking : Pahalgam is one of the most famous trekking destinations in Pahalgam. Tourists can trek from Main Pahalgam to Sheeshnag Lake and enjoy a time filled with fun and beauty.
  2. Camping: Camping is also a famous tourist attraction in Pahalgam Valley. Campers are usually stationed in Aru Valley and enjoy their night stay looking at the stars.
  3. Picnic and Sightseeing: you can also spend quality time in Pahalgam by staying on the plains and explore the beauty of the valley. You can enjoy Wildlife exploration, Picnicking and Water Rafting in Lidder River.
